Ramsey could be getting another 17 telegraph poles after Manx Telecom submitted two planning applications.
The company says it wants to provide fibre broadband in Greenlands Avenue and Laurys Avenue.
In its plans, it says it needs the poles to provide the lines to a number of homes in both areas.
Last month it submitted four separate applications for nine poles in Princes Road, Barrule Park and Westbourne Close.
